MC74HC32A Quad 2-Input OR Gate HighPerformance SiliconGate CMOS The MC74HC32A is identical in pinout to the LS32. The device inputs are compatible with Standard CMOS outputs with pullup resistors, they are compatible with LSTTL outputs.
